推荐开源项目:PDFPC - 轻量级、高效的PDF阅读器
项目简介
PDFPC(PDF Presentation Console)是一个轻量级的,专为演示设计的PDF阅读器。它支持全屏模式,具备平滑的幻灯片切换效果,并提供简洁的用户界面,让你专注于内容本身而非软件工具。该项目在上开源,允许用户自由地下载、使用和贡献代码。
技术分析
PDFPC的核心是用C++编写的,它利用Qt框架来构建用户界面,这使得软件跨平台兼容,可以在Windows、Linux和macOS等操作系统上运行。对于PDF处理,PDFPC依赖于poppler库,一个强大的PDF解析和渲染库,确保了对PDF文件的良好支持和快速加载。
此外,PDFPC的设计理念注重效率和性能。它避免了不必要的复杂功能,只保留了演示文稿所需的基本操作,如平移、缩放、幻灯片切换等。这种设计使其启动速度快,占用系统资源少,特别是在老旧或者低配设备上依然能流畅运行。
应用场景
- 学术报告:科研人员可以借助PDFPC进行论文展示,清晰的页面切换与全屏模式有助于观众集中注意力。
- 商业演讲:企业人士可以用它进行产品演示或商业计划书讲解,其简洁的界面不会分散观众对核心信息的关注。
- 教育授课:教师可以轻松地将PDF教材转化为动态的教学课件,提高课堂互动性。
- 个人分享:无论是在小型聚会还是线上分享中,PDFPC都是分享PDF文档的理想选择。
特点概述
- 轻量级:体积小巧,快速启动,不占太多系统资源。
- 全屏模式:专注内容展示,无多余干扰元素。
- 平滑过渡:幻灯片切换流畅自然,提升观看体验。
- 跨平台:支持Windows、Linux和macOS操作系统。
- 开放源码:可自由修改和扩展,鼓励社区参与开发。
- 命令行工具:提供命令行接口,方便自动化操作。
如果你正在寻找一个简单高效、又不失专业感的PDF阅读器,那么PDFPC绝对值得尝试。前往下载并体验吧!无论是日常办公还是公共演讲,PDFPC都能成为你的得力助手。